Dupont is a village in Putnam County.
The community was named after Rear Admiral S.F. DuPont, a Union commander during the Civil War
The latitude of Dupont is 41.056N. The longitude is -84.304W.
It is in the Eastern Standard time zone. Elevation is 725 feet.The estimated population, in 2003, was 271.

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Dupont was $12,879, compared with $21,587 nationally.
5% of Dupont resid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Median rent in Dupont, at the time of the 2000 Census, was $265. Monthly homeowner costs, for people with mortgages, were $633.

The average commute time for Dupont workers is 21 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
